This style substantially lowers heat loss, minimizes outdoors noise, and increases total energy effectiveness. Nevertheless, it is important to maintain the stability of the window seals to avoid moisture build-up.&amp;lt;br&amp;gt;Reasons For Double Glazing Moisture&amp;lt;br&amp;gt;Moisture between double-glazed panes normally indicates a failure of the window seals. Here are some typical causes:&amp;lt;br&amp;gt;CauseDescriptionSeal FailureThe most typical reason for moisture build-up is that the seal between the 2 panes has actually deteriorated, permitting air and moisture to go into.Temperature level FluctuationsFast temperature level changes can cause the seals to expand and contract, causing ultimate failure.Improper InstallationIf the window was not set up properly, it may not create an airtight seal, enabling moisture to leak in with time.AgeOlder double-glazed windows are more susceptible to seal failure as the materials utilized can degrade gradually.Poor Quality MaterialsWindows made with lower-quality products are more susceptible to use and tear, resulting in seal failure.External FactorsEcological factors like high humidity, flooding, and severe weather conditions can likewise add to seal deterioration.Effects of Moisture in Double Glazing&amp;lt;br&amp;gt;If double-glazed windows develop moisture, it can lead to a number of issues:&amp;lt;br&amp;gt;&amp;lt;br&amp;gt;Reduced Energy Efficiency: Moisture accumulation minimizes the insulating homes of double glazing, resulting in greater energy costs.&amp;lt;br&amp;gt;&amp;lt;br&amp;gt;Foggy Windows: The visibility may be impaired due to condensation, causing a visually displeasing look.&amp;lt;br&amp;gt;&amp;lt;br&amp;gt;Mold Growth: Persistent moisture supplies a perfect environment for mold and mildew to develop, which can be hazardous to health.&amp;lt;br&amp;gt;&amp;lt;br&amp;gt;Decreased Lifespan: The stability of double-glazed windows reduces with moisture, potentially resulting in the requirement for costly replacements.&amp;lt;br&amp;gt;&amp;lt;br&amp;gt;Structural Damage: In extreme cases, prolonged moisture can damage the window frame and adjacent walls, causing extensive repairs.&amp;lt;br&amp;gt;Determining Double Glazing Moisture&amp;lt;br&amp;gt;To determine whether moisture exists in your double-glazed windows, watch for the following signs:&amp;lt;br&amp;gt;Condensation: Water droplets forming between the glass panes.Fogginess: A cloudy look that lessens clarity.Mold: The existence of mold or mildew around window seals or frames.Contorting: Visible distortion of the window frame.Solutions for Double Glazing Moisture&amp;lt;br&amp;gt;If you discover moisture in your double-glazing, there are a couple of solutions readily available:&amp;lt;br&amp;gt;1. Repairing or Replacing Seals&amp;lt;br&amp;gt;Replacing harmed seals is often the most reliable solution. Knowledgeable technicians can repair or replace the seals, bring back the performance of your double-glazing.&amp;lt;br&amp;gt;2. Desiccant Devices&amp;lt;br&amp;gt;Some homeowners select desiccant gadgets that can take in moisture in the space between the panes. However, this is typically a short-lived solution.&amp;lt;br&amp;gt;3. Defogging Services&amp;lt;br&amp;gt;Professional defogging services can remove the moisture and bring back exposure by making use of customized equipment to leave the air and moisture.&amp;lt;br&amp;gt;4. Window Replacement&amp;lt;br&amp;gt;In cases where damage is comprehensive, replacing the entire window unit might be essential. This is typically the very best long-term solution for major moisture concerns.&amp;lt;br&amp;gt;5. Preventive Measures&amp;lt;br&amp;gt;To prevent future concerns, consider the following preventive measures:&amp;lt;br&amp;gt;Monitor humidity levels in your home.Ensure correct ventilation in areas vulnerable to moisture, such as kitchen areas and restrooms.Regularly examine windows and frames for indications of wear.Cost Implications&amp;lt;br&amp;gt;The cost of addressing moisture in double glazing can differ substantially depending upon the intensity of the problem and the picked option.
